The volume of olive oil shipped by Portugal in 2020 was 213,290 tonnes. In 2019 Portugal exported 29,734 tonnes of olive oil. For the year 2019 alone, the interest in Portugal olive oil (processed category) has gone down, recording a change of -84.459 pc compared to the year 2018. Between 2017 and 2019, olive oil's exports went down by -77.81 pc netting the country US$625.91m for the year 2019. Portugal's olive oil exports are categorised as:
- Virgin olive oil and its fractions obtained from the fruit of the olive tree solely by mechanical or other physical means under conditions that do not lead to deterioration of the oil (HS code 150910)
- Olive oil and fractions obtained from the fruit of the olive tree solely by mechanical or other physical means under conditions that do not lead to deterioration of the oil (excluding virgin and chemically modified) (HS code 150990)
- Other oils and their fractions, obtained solely from olives, whether or not refined, but not chemically modified, incl. blends of these oils or fractions with oils or fractions of heading 1509 (HS code 151000)

Portugal Óleo de azeite export values
In 2019, Portugal shipped olive oil costing 625.91m USD, a decrease of -20.34% from 2018's total olive oil export of 785.761m USD. The yearly change in value of Portugal olive oil between 2017 to 2018 was 33.801 per cent.
The per year variation in the amount of Portugal's olive oil exports between 2017 and 2019 was -77.81 percent when compared to a variation of -84.459% in the growth rate between 2018 and 2019.
Portugal's share of the world's total olive oil's exports in 2019 was less than 1%. The country is ranked position 27 in world exports of olive oil.

Import/Export Trends
Portugal is a net importer of olive oil. The annual growth of Portugal olive oil in value between 2015 to 2019 was 30%, per year, while annual growth in quantity through the same period was 12%, per annum.
Portugal procured 130,268 tonnes of olive oil in 2019.
